Bleichroeder Acquisition Corp. II Class A Ordinary Shares
FINANCIAL SERVICES · SHELL COMPANIES · USA
Bleichroeder Acquisition Corp. II is a strategically focused special purpose acquisition company (SPAC) dedicated to merging with pioneering businesses in dynamic, high-growth sectors. Backed by an experienced management team and a strong network of industry advisors, the company is poised to leverage market disruptions and maximize value creation for its investors. With an adaptive investment approach that targets emerging market trends, Bleichroeder Acquisition Corp. II presents attractive opportunities for institutional investors looking to participate in transformative industries.
